Officers in Surprise, Arizona, forced their way into a home knowing they could confront the baby’s father in any room. They used the baby’s cries to find him.
In May, the Surprise Police Department reported it received a 911 call about a woman and her child who were being held hostage. While the mother escaped, the baby was still trapped inside with his father. Officers heard gunfire and forced their way into the house. This article was written by Fox News staff.
Officers said they busted in knowing they could confront the baby’s father in any room. As they cleared each room, they heard the infant’s cries coming from a back room in the home.
